Theory Group Seminar, 04 November 2008


Louis Leblond, Texas A&M University

Cosmological Signatures from the End of Brane Inflation

abstract

A common feature of many string inspired models of inflation is that the inflationary era ends abruptly by tachyon condensation. In this talk, I will discuss some possible phenomenological consequences of this type of exit from inflation. These include the possibility of generating density perturbations (with a non-Gaussian spectrum) that could be observed in the CMB as well as leftover cosmic strings (with new properties) that can be observed in various ways.
